Output a3587c3ce2c6fe78ee44f10791919c0335cc3ae8f9a1d4e37921e926b4609b89:44

value
68994020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f3ded9caf547a9ad5e50eaafa049ff31f001f86 OP_EQUAL
address
MDfYzMrR8TagbXCGLuMRYPA5EYnP3kpC8x
transaction
a3587c3ce2c6fe78ee44f10791919c0335cc3ae8f9a1d4e37921e926b4609b89
spent
true